City of Seaford Plumbing Bond
What it is & who requires it
Any person, firm or corporation engaging in the business of plumbing in the City of Seaford must first obtain a city plumbing license and deposit with the City a $5,000 surety bond, approved by the City Solicitor, guaranteeing faithful observance of the laws pertaining to plumbing, drain laying and excavation. A city-licensed plumber may perform shallow street excavation without the separate excavator license.
Obligee: City of Seaford. Citation: Code of the City of Seaford, Chapter 9 (Plumbing), § 9.2.9 (Bond required — City Plumber License).
Bond amount
The required bond amount is $5,000.

Term & renewal
Term: Held while the plumbing license is in effect; approved by the City Solicitor; conditioned on faithful observance of all laws pertaining to plumbing, drain laying and excavation.
Renewal: Maintained as a condition of the Seaford city plumbing license.
Filing
Filed with the City of Seaford and approved by the City Solicitor as a condition of the city plumbing license, conditioned on faithful observance of all laws pertaining to plumbing, drain laying and excavation. Required under the Code of the City of Seaford, Chapter 9 (Plumbing), §9.2.9.

- Is this bond insurance for me?
- No. It protects the obligee and the public — not you. If a valid claim is paid, you repay the surety.
